NEMA says 11 died, 77 injured in Adamawa blasts

The suicide bomb attack happened on Friday, January 29, 2016, two days after multiple blast occurred in Chibok town, Borno State.

 

The acting Coordinator of National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A) in Adamawa state, Mr Halilu Kangiwa  has revealed to newsmen that 11 people have died so far and 77 people were injured in the twin suicide bomb attack n Gombi market in Adamawa state.

Kangiwa said “We now have 58 others with serious injuries undergoing treatment in hospitals in Gombi and Yola towns.”

Reports said the market attracts large crowd including people from Cameroon and other neighbouring countries.
